This role is for a Principal Powertrain Engineer at Anduril, a defense technology company. The engineer will design, develop, and integrate a high-performance hybrid-electric propulsion system for the Omen autonomous air vehicle. Responsibilities include owning powertrain component design from concept to production, optimizing for VTOL operations, leading testing and validation, and collaborating with cross-functional teams. The role requires significant experience in powertrain engineering and leadership, with a focus on electric or hybrid propulsion systems for aerospace platforms.

What you'd actually do

  1. Own the design of hybrid-electric propulsion systems including motors, generators, battery packs, fuel systems, power electronics, and propeller/rotor integration
  2. Electric machine sizing and design, transmission sizing and design, inverter sizing and design, and how the full system integrates into the air vehicle.
  3. Conduct powertrain performance analysis, thermal modeling, and energy optimization studies to meet mission requirements for endurance, payload capacity, and operational envelope
  4. Lead the development and execution of test plans for powertrain subsystems and full-up systems, including ground test stands, HILs, and flight test
  5. Define and validate technical performance measures including power, efficiency, thermal limits, and fault tolerance across all operating modes
